A Step-by-Step Guide to Finding All Whacks (Spoiler Light)
While we won’t ruin every single surprise (there are over 20 unique deaths in Whack Your Boss 3), here are the primary categories of kills you need to hunt for to achieve 100% completion:
- The Ceiling Fan: Classic, but with a twist. You need to first grease the fan with a donut.
- The Golf Club: The boss loves golf. Click his bag. But beware—he might see you if you aren't fast.
- The Toxic Coffee: This is a two-parter. Take the coffee pot to the cleaning closet, then return it to the burner.
- The Server Room: If your office has an IT closet, click the mainframe. The boss will go in to "fix it." You know what to do.
- The Vending Machine Trap: Insert a coin, shake the machine, and stand back.
Pro Tip: The final whack is always the hardest to find. In Whack Your Boss 3, the secret lies in the boss's own chair. Click the armrest five times slowly, not twice quickly.

Step-by-Step Guide to Unlocking All Kills
If you are stuck trying to 100% Whack Your Boss 3, here is a spoiler-heavy walkthrough. The office has four quadrants: The Desk, The Breakroom, The Cubicle Farm, and The Parking Garage (accessible via elevator).
The Classic (Desk):
- The Stapler: Click the stapler, then click the boss’s forehead.
- The Phone: Slam the rotary phone into his temple.
- The Drawer: Open the bottom drawer, click the secret whiskey bottle, get him drunk, then push him down the stairs.
The High-Tech Kills:
- The Laser Printer: Wait for him to lean over to inspect a jam. Press "Print." The roller does the rest.
- The Monitor: Type an email that says "You’re fired." When he reads it, his head explodes from rage. (Yes, this is a real kill.)
The "How Did They Think of That?" Kills:
- The Pigeon: Click the window to open it. A pigeon flies in. Use the bagel to lure the pigeon to the boss’s shoulder. The pigeon pecks his eyes out.
- The Ceiling Tile: Click the tile four times until a mysterious anvil falls. (Wile E. Coyote homage).
